Year: 2002
Runtime: 84 mins
Language: English
Director: Rod Daniel
Bigger house, bigger laughs. After his parents split, Kevin stays with his mother but decides to celebrate Christmas at his father's mansion, owned by his rich girlfriend Natalie. Meanwhile, longtime burglar Marv Merchants teams up with a new accomplice, Vera, to target Natalie’s lavish home. The sprawling estate becomes the focus of their scheme.
